Get rid of the annoying Office assistant once and for all.

Yes, I know. Clippy is annoying. He pops up to remind you of your dumb mistakes, your missed keystrokes. He is always trying to second-guess you, and he thinks you want his friendly suggestions. Now, thanks to "The Screen Savers," you have the power to kill Clippy.

Office 2000 allows you to selectively uninstall office components.

  1. Open the Add/Remove Programs dialogue box from the control panel.
  2. Double-click Microsoft Office 2000, or select it and click Change.
  3. You will get a Maintenance Mode window. Click Add or Remove Features.
  4. Clippie lives in Office Tools. Click the plus sign next to Office Tools and then click Office Assistant.
  5. Choose "Not Available" from the menu.
